#1e834e hex color
In a RGB color space, hex #1e834e is composed of 11.8% red, 51.4% green and 30.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 77.1% cyan, 0% magenta, 40.5% yellow and 48.6% black. It has a hue angle of 148.5 degrees, a saturation of 62.7% and a lightness of 31.6%. #1e834e color hex could be obtained by blending #3cff9c with #000700. Closest websafe color is: #339966.

● #1e834e color description : Dark cyan - lime green.
The hexadecimal color #1e834e has RGB values of R:30, G:131, B:78 and CMYK values of C:0.77, M:0, Y:0.4, K:0.49. Its decimal value is 1999694.
